Location: US Web: www.quickreaver.com Email: alizarin_griffin@yahoo.com media: Conté crayons, charcoal, graphite, inks, oils Christine’s inspirations lie in beauty gone askew, the devil in the details and the human animal. “Working in a variety of media has been tricky and rewarding,” she says. “With digital, there isn’t a colour you can’t pick, a change you can’t make. Nothing beats delivery to a client by simply hitting Send.
“On the other hand, there’s something so satisfying about working with traditional media. The grit of pencil on paper, the smell of solvents, that hallowed original, which is almost impossible to create digitally. Traditional art is deliciously tangible.”
For this artist, painting has to fit around the roles of mother and wife: “Squeezing in time to make art has been a slippery balance between chores, chauffeuring and an easily distracted muse,” she says.
